Supernova distance measurements suggest an older, larger Universe.
DOI: 10.1063/1.2809865 Bibcode: 1992PhT....45k..17S

Schwarzschild, Bertram

Three determinations of the Hubble constant from supernova observations are reviewed and compared to existing data on the age and size of the universe.
